After a shocking Game 1 loss at home, the Utah Jazz have bounced back to win three straight games over the Memphis Grizzlies and take a 3-1 lead in their first round series. Game 4 on Monday night followed a similar pattern to the last two games, as the Jazz led for the most of the night, but had to hold off a furious Grizzlies comeback before eventually securing a 120-113 win, thanks to Mike Conley.
Donovan Mitchell led the way with 30 points and eight assists, Jordan Clarkson came off the bench to drop 24 points and Rudy Gobert put up 17 points and eight assists. But while those usual suspects put up their numbers, Mike Conley was the real hero for the Jazz in Game.

With a clutch sequence late in the fourth quarter, Conley saved the Jazz from another playoff collapse. The Jazz led by 13, and appeared to be well on their way to victory. A few minutes later, Jazz had missed nine shots, and De’Anthony Melton caught fire for the Grizzlies. Jazz was clinging to a two-point lead. That’s when Conley stepped up. Conley had two 3s and a steal in less than two minutes.

The Grizzlies didn’t get closer until the dying seconds, when the game was already decided. If you looked through the box score, you’d hardly notice Conley’s 11 points and seven assists. But the Jazz wouldn’t win without Conley steady presence and massive plays down the stretch.
With those shots and a steal in the end, Conley made sure the Jazz are taking Game 5 back home with a lead of 3-1. Now, they’re just one win away from advancing to the second round for the first time since 2018, and ending a run of three straight first-round exits.
These two teams will meet again on Thursday for Game 5 of the series.
